loadpatents
Patent applications and USPTO patent grants for Ahrens; Matthew A..The latest application filed is for "block-based incremental backup".
Patent | Date |
---|---|
Method and system for encrypting data Grant 9,742,564 - Moffat , et al. August 22, 2 | 2017-08-22 |
Method and system for metadata-based resilvering Grant 8,938,594 - Moore , et al. January 20, 2 | 2015-01-20 |
Method and system for pruned resilvering using a dirty time log Grant 8,635,190 - Moore , et al. January 21, 2 | 2014-01-21 |
Unlimited file system snapshots and clones Grant 8,549,051 - Ahrens , et al. October 1, 2 | 2013-10-01 |
Method and system for adaptive metadata replication Grant 8,495,010 - Moore , et al. July 23, 2 | 2013-07-23 |
Storage pool scrubbing with concurrent snapshots Grant 8,280,858 - Ahrens , et al. October 2, 2 | 2012-10-02 |
Block-based Incremental Backup App 20120005163 - Ahrens; Matthew A. ;   et al. | 2012-01-05 |
Method and system for pruned resilvering using a dirty time log Grant 8,069,156 - Moore , et al. November 29, 2 | 2011-11-29 |
Method And System For Encrypting Data App 20110283113 - Moffat; Darren J. ;   et al. | 2011-11-17 |
Method and system for data replication Grant 7,882,420 - Moore , et al. February 1, 2 | 2011-02-01 |
Method and system for block reallocation Grant 7,877,554 - Bonwick , et al. January 25, 2 | 2011-01-25 |
Storage Pool Scrubbing With Concurrent Snapshots App 20100332446 - Ahrens; Matthew A. ;   et al. | 2010-12-30 |
Inheritable file system properties Grant 7,761,432 - Ahrens , et al. July 20, 2 | 2010-07-20 |
Ditto blocks Grant 7,743,225 - Bonwick , et al. June 22, 2 | 2010-06-22 |
Method And System For Pruned Resilvering Using A Dirty Time Log App 20100145919 - Moore; William H. ;   et al. | 2010-06-10 |
Method and system for storing a sparse file using fill counts Grant 7,716,445 - Bonwick , et al. May 11, 2 | 2010-05-11 |
Adaptive resilvering I/O scheduling Grant 7,657,671 - Bonwick , et al. February 2, 2 | 2010-02-02 |
Method And System For Data Replication App 20090313532 - Moore; William H. ;   et al. | 2009-12-17 |
Method and apparatus for self-validating checksums in a file system Grant 7,603,568 - Ahrens , et al. October 13, 2 | 2009-10-13 |
Method and system for data replication Grant 7,596,739 - Moore , et al. September 29, 2 | 2009-09-29 |
Method and apparatus for enabling adaptive endianness Grant 7,533,225 - Bonwick , et al. May 12, 2 | 2009-05-12 |
Compressed victim cache Grant 7,526,615 - Bonwick , et al. April 28, 2 | 2009-04-28 |
Method and system for detecting and correcting data errors using checksums and replication Grant 7,526,622 - Bonwick , et al. April 28, 2 | 2009-04-28 |
Method and apparatus for compressing data in a file system Grant 7,496,586 - Bonwick , et al. February 24, 2 | 2009-02-24 |
Method and system for object allocation using fill counts Grant 7,480,684 - Bonwick , et al. January 20, 2 | 2009-01-20 |
Adaptive replacement cache Grant 7,469,320 - Bonwick , et al. December 23, 2 | 2008-12-23 |
Gang blocks Grant 7,437,528 - Moore , et al. October 14, 2 | 2008-10-14 |
Method and apparatus for dynamic striping Grant 7,424,574 - Ahrens , et al. September 9, 2 | 2008-09-09 |
Method and apparatus for vectored block-level checksum for file system data integrity Grant 7,415,653 - Bonwick , et al. August 19, 2 | 2008-08-19 |
Method and apparatus for identifying tampering of data in a file system Grant 7,412,450 - Bonwick , et al. August 12, 2 | 2008-08-12 |
Method and system for detecting and correcting data errors using data permutations Grant 7,281,188 - Bonwick , et al. October 9, 2 | 2007-10-09 |
Adaptive resilvering I/O scheduling App 20070168569 - Bonwick; Jeffrey S. ;   et al. | 2007-07-19 |
Method and system for data replication App 20070124659 - Moore; William H. ;   et al. | 2007-05-31 |
Automatic conversion of all-zero data storage blocks into file holes Grant 7,225,314 - Bonwick , et al. May 29, 2 | 2007-05-29 |
Method and system for adaptive metadata replication App 20070118576 - Moore; William H. ;   et al. | 2007-05-24 |
Extensible hashing for file system directories App 20070118578 - Ahrens; Matthew A. ;   et al. | 2007-05-24 |
Directory entry locks App 20070112771 - Maybee; Mark J. ;   et al. | 2007-05-17 |
Block-based incremental backup App 20070112895 - Ahrens; Matthew A. ;   et al. | 2007-05-17 |
Method and system for storing a sparse file using fill counts App 20070106863 - Bonwick; Jeffrey S. ;   et al. | 2007-05-10 |
Hierarchical file system naming App 20070106700 - Ahrens; Matthew A. ;   et al. | 2007-05-10 |
Method and system for block reallocation App 20070106870 - Bonwick; Jeffrey S. ;   et al. | 2007-05-10 |
Method and system for pruned resilvering using a dirty time log App 20070106677 - Moore; William H. ;   et al. | 2007-05-10 |
Adaptive replacement cache App 20070106846 - Bonwick; Jeffrey S. ;   et al. | 2007-05-10 |
Ditto blocks App 20070106862 - Bonwick; Jeffrey S. ;   et al. | 2007-05-10 |
Method and system for object allocation using fill counts App 20070106632 - Bonwick; Jeffrey S. ;   et al. | 2007-05-10 |
Inheritable file system properties App 20070106678 - Ahrens; Matthew A. ;   et al. | 2007-05-10 |
Method and system for metadata-based resilvering App 20070106866 - Moore; William H. ;   et al. | 2007-05-10 |
Unlimited file system snapshots and clones App 20070106706 - Ahrens; Matthew A. ;   et al. | 2007-05-10 |
Compressed victim cache App 20070106847 - Bonwick; Jeffrey S. ;   et al. | 2007-05-10 |
uspto.report is an independent third-party trademark research tool that is not affiliated, endorsed, or sponsored by the United States Patent and Trademark Office (USPTO) or any other governmental organization. The information provided by uspto.report is based on publicly available data at the time of writing and is intended for informational purposes only.
While we strive to provide accurate and up-to-date information, we do not guarantee the accuracy, completeness, reliability, or suitability of the information displayed on this site. The use of this site is at your own risk. Any reliance you place on such information is therefore strictly at your own risk.
All official trademark data, including owner information, should be verified by visiting the official USPTO website at www.uspto.gov. This site is not intended to replace professional legal advice and should not be used as a substitute for consulting with a legal professional who is knowledgeable about trademark law.